Honda CB350 Features and Competition:
- Telescopic Forks and Modern Features: The CB350 showcases a captivating design with telescopic forks at the front and gas-charged rear springs at the back, ensuring a smooth and controlled ride. It boasts modern features such as ABS indicator, high-speed alert, Bluetooth connectivity, smartphone connectivity, and turn-by-turn navigation – setting it apart from the Royal Enfield Classic 350.

Honda CB350 Powerhouse Engine:
- 348.66 cc Dominance: The heart of the Honda CB350 is its 348.66 cc single-cylinder, air-cooled, 4-valve engine. Generating a formidable power of 20.5bhp at 5,500 rpm and a peak torque of 29.4nm at 3,000 rpm, this engine is mated to a five-speed gearbox, propelling the CB350 to a top speed of 130 kilometers per hour.
